VISION
To promote the health of South African by addressing social, economic, political and environmental factors that impact on health and well - being by developing a cadre of Health Promotion researchers and practitioners to enable the development of appropriate programmes aimed at meeting the Health Promotion needs of the country. This will be achieved by optimum utilization of Health Promotion resources, and collaboration with relevant stakeholders. This approach to improving the health status of all South Africans is underpinned by the National Health Plan (1994) and the White Paper for the transformation of Health Services (1997) which emphasize Health Promotion as central to Primary Health Care.
